Как мне узнать, обрывается ли соединение в маршрутизаторе с балансировкой нагрузки?

Я использую маршрутизатор балансировки нагрузки TL-R470T+ для объединения двух широкополосных соединений. Есть ли способ узнать, как только одна из широкополосных линий выйдет из строя?

Мой подход пока:

Я попытался настроить политику маршрутизации, чтобы выяснить решение. Я взял два IP. Я назначил первый IP-адрес для использования только WAN1, а второй IP-адрес - только для LAN2. Я создал скрипт, который пингует оба IP-адреса и предупреждает меня, если один из них не работает.

Однако я понимаю, что как только WAN1 выходит из строя, первый IP начинает использовать WAN2. Следовательно, я никогда не узнаю, что WAN1 вышел из строя.

Есть ли этому решение?

3 ответа

У вас есть два варианта:

Включите SNMP на маршрутизаторе и используйте протокол SNMP для мониторинга канала WAN.

Включите пересылку журнала событий на маршрутизаторе.

Использование tracert чтобы просмотреть первые несколько прыжков пинга на внешний сервер. Вы можете проверить результаты в скрипте и легко определить, какое соединение используется.

Я создал плагин PRTG, в котором я работаю, и который делает именно это, и он работал много лет.

Маршрутизаторы балансировки нагрузки должны иметь методы обнаружения. Обычно они могут быть настроены для проверки связи с внешним IP-адресом и, следовательно, для определения, когда линия не работает. Кроме того, они могут быть настроены на отправку оповещения, когда линия не работает.

Ваш скрипт также должен быть жизнеспособным, если он выполнен правильно, потому что при переключении линий произойдет потеря пакета, поэтому вы сможете обнаружить сбитую линию.

Другие вопросы по тегам